This role will report directly to the Director of Investor Relations and support the Investor Relations team with various aspects of existing institutional investor relationship management. Optionality to support and gain exposure to other adjacent departments: Capital Raising and Portfolio Management. Ideal position for candidate with prior experience (internships or work experience) in Real Estate Capital Markets, Investment Banking, Corporate Finance, or Commercial Real Estate. Opportunity to gain a deep understanding of the U.S. multifamily landscape, build hands-on experience with large institutional private equity real estate funds, and work closely with influential senior leaders at the forefront of the industry.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Partner internally to drive completion of ad hoc quantitative and qualitative requests from investors, completion of recurring investor materials (i.e. quarterly templates and reports), management of Bell Partner’s Investor Portal, and management of its investor request inbox

  • Support creation of PowerPoint presentations and organization/logistics around various investor meetings and tours including support for the Bell Partners Annual Investor Meeting

  • Maintain organized record of correspondence with investors and materials

  • Opportunity to support creation of new venture fundraising materials including PPM, DDQ, Pitchbook, and Fund Financial Model

  • Work directly with established team and work closely with Bell Partners’ Senior Management team on high visibility investor facing projects

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Economics, Finance, or similar *Required

  • Strong pro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ite: Excel, PowerPoint, and Word *Required

  • Familiarity with Juniper Square and Salesforce software preferred

  • Prior internship experience in Investment Banking, Corporate Finance, or Commercial Real Estate

  • Strong work ethic, positive/“self-starter” attitude, agile learning ability, adaptability to various and evolving team needs, strong organization and time management skills

  • Strong interpersonal, professional, and cross-functional communication skills

What We Do

Established in 1976, Bell Partners Inc. (“Bell Partners” or the “Company”) is a privately held, vertically integrated apartment investment and management company focused on high-quality multifamily communities throughout the United States. Bell Partners is a best in class apartment operator, with nearly 70,000 homes across 13 states and the District of Columbia, and is one of the largest apartment renovators in the industry. The Company has over 1,600 associates and 11 offices (including its headquarters in Greensboro, NC) and offers an extensive and full service operating platform containing expertise in acquisitions and dispositions, financing, property operations, accounting, risk management and all other related support functions. Bell Partners is led by a senior management team with an average of over 20 years of experience that has invested throughout all phases of the real estate cycle and has helped the Company complete over $22 billion of apartment transactions since 2002.
